This view eastwards from Park Lane bridge shows how the course of the former Great Northern Railway line from Nottingham to Derby Friargate has been obliterated since it closed in 1968. Ben Brooksbank's Image] shows what the lines east of here looked like in the days of steam; the position of the engine in that picture was just beyond the houses straight ahead.
